In today’s fast-paced and stress-oriented world, it is hard for young people to stop and search for God’s will for their lives. A young person's life is full of decisions: what to do after high school, what career to pursue, whom to marry, and where to live. These are only a few of the questions they face. Without God’s guidance, the future is overwhelming, worrisome and frightening. Exploring God’s Purpose for Your Life, a six session series explores the path to finding God’s will, helping young people to hear his purpose for their lives. ThisDVD has six segments: God Has a Purpose for Your Life, Seeking God, Obstacles to Hearing God, Trusting God, Making Decisions and Steps of Faith. A study guide is included.
Join Tony Jones in The Faith and Practice of the Earliest Christians as he unveils this late first-century text: the Didache, or "Teaching of the Twelve. You will explore what some of the earliest Christians lived and taught. What is 'The Way of Jesus"? How important are "Baptism and Holy Communion"? What does it mean to "Be Church"? When is it good to "Look to the Future? Why is it important for Christians to look "Back to the Roots of Faith? This essential study in the life and practice of the Early Church will challenge any study group, home church, highschool, college or adult discussion group.
